Some Fluid mappings (#421)

This commit is contained in:
Virtuoel 2019-01-24 16:08:16 +03:00 committed by Adrian Siekierka
parent 78cd45cfea
commit 3624162aea
7 changed files with 20 additions and 2 deletions

View File

@ -1,9 +1,10 @@
CLASS cfu net/minecraft/fluid/BaseFluid
FIELD a STILL Lbra;
FIELD a FALLING Lbra;
FIELD b LEVEL Lbri;
METHOD a (IZ)Lcfw;
ARG 1 level
ARG 2 still
METHOD a onScheduledTick (Lbci;Let;Lcfw;)V
METHOD a (Lbcm;Let;Lbqi;)Lcfw;
ARG 1 world
ARG 2 pos

View File

@ -1,8 +1,10 @@
CLASS cft net/minecraft/fluid/EmptyFluid
METHOD a getRenderLayer ()Lbbu;
METHOD a getTickRate (Lbcm;)I
METHOD a toBlockState (Lcfw;)Lbqi;
METHOD b getBucketItem ()Lawx;
METHOD b isStill (Lcfw;)Z
METHOD b getShape (Lcfw;Lbbt;Let;)Lcnr;
METHOD c isEmpty ()Z
METHOD c getLevel (Lcfw;)I
METHOD d getBlastResistance ()F

View File

@ -3,6 +3,9 @@ CLASS cfv net/minecraft/fluid/Fluid
FIELD c STATE_IDS Lfc;
FIELD d stateFactory Lbqj;
METHOD a getRenderLayer ()Lbbu;
METHOD a onScheduledTick (Lbci;Let;Lcfw;)V
METHOD a randomDisplayTick (Lbci;Let;Lcfw;Ljava/util/Random;)V
METHOD a getTickRate (Lbcm;)I
METHOD a appendProperties (Lbqj$a;)V
METHOD a matchesType (Lcfv;)Z
METHOD a toBlockState (Lcfw;)Lbqi;
@ -12,6 +15,7 @@ CLASS cfv net/minecraft/fluid/Fluid
METHOD b isStill (Lcfw;)Z
METHOD b getShape (Lcfw;Lbbt;Let;)Lcnr;
METHOD c isEmpty ()Z
METHOD c getLevel (Lcfw;)I
METHOD d getBlastResistance ()F
METHOD e setDefaultState (Lcfw;)V
METHOD h getStateFactory ()Lbqj;

View File

@ -1,4 +1,6 @@
CLASS cfw net/minecraft/fluid/FluidState
METHOD a onScheduledTick (Lbci;Let;)V
METHOD a randomDisplayTick (Lbci;Let;Ljava/util/Random;)V
METHOD a deserialize (Lcom/mojang/datafixers/Dynamic;)Lcfw;
ARG 0 dynamic
METHOD a serialize (Lcom/mojang/datafixers/types/DynamicOps;Lcfw;)Lcom/mojang/datafixers/Dynamic;
@ -10,6 +12,7 @@ CLASS cfw net/minecraft/fluid/FluidState
METHOD d isStill ()Z
METHOD d getShape (Lbbt;Let;)Lcnr;
METHOD e isEmpty ()Z
METHOD f getLevel ()I
METHOD g hasRandomTicks ()Z
METHOD h getBlockState ()Lbqi;
METHOD j getRenderLayer ()Lbbu;

View File

@ -2,9 +2,13 @@ CLASS cfz net/minecraft/fluid/LavaFluid
CLASS cfz$a Flowing
METHOD a appendProperties (Lbqj$a;)V
METHOD b isStill (Lcfw;)Z
METHOD c getLevel (Lcfw;)I
CLASS cfz$b Still
METHOD b isStill (Lcfw;)Z
METHOD c getLevel (Lcfw;)I
METHOD a getRenderLayer ()Lbbu;
METHOD a randomDisplayTick (Lbci;Let;Lcfw;Ljava/util/Random;)V
METHOD a getTickRate (Lbcm;)I
METHOD a matchesType (Lcfv;)Z
METHOD a toBlockState (Lcfw;)Lbqi;
METHOD b getBucketItem ()Lawx;

View File

@ -2,9 +2,13 @@ CLASS cgd net/minecraft/fluid/WaterFluid
CLASS cgd$a Flowing
METHOD a appendProperties (Lbqj$a;)V
METHOD b isStill (Lcfw;)Z
METHOD c getLevel (Lcfw;)I
CLASS cgd$b Still
METHOD b isStill (Lcfw;)Z
METHOD c getLevel (Lcfw;)I
METHOD a getRenderLayer ()Lbbu;
METHOD a randomDisplayTick (Lbci;Let;Lcfw;Ljava/util/Random;)V
METHOD a getTickRate (Lbcm;)I
METHOD a matchesType (Lcfv;)Z
METHOD a toBlockState (Lcfw;)Lbqi;
METHOD b getBucketItem ()Lawx;

View File

@ -45,7 +45,7 @@ CLASS bqz net/minecraft/state/property/Properties
FIELD ak LAYERS Lbri;
FIELD al CAULDRON_LEVEL Lbri;
FIELD am COMPOSTER_LEVEL Lbri;
FIELD an BLOCK_LEVEL Lbri;
FIELD an FLUID_LEVEL Lbri;
FIELD ao FLUID_BLOCK_LEVEL Lbri;
FIELD ap MOISTURE Lbri;
FIELD aq NOTE Lbri;